Security researchers and malicious actors use these specific search queries to find vulnerable Internet of Things (IoT) devices. In this case, the target is exposed Axis network cameras and video servers.

The phrase is a classic "Google Dork"—a specific search string used by security researchers and malicious actors to find exposed Axis video servers on the open web. By indexing specific file paths like indexFrame.shtml , search engines inadvertently reveal the administrative or live-view portals of these devices. 1. What is an Axis Video Server?

indexframe.shtml is a filename used in older Axis video server web interfaces (e.g., Axis 2400, 241Q, 241S). These devices convert analog video to IP streams and include a built-in web server for configuration and live viewing.
